Creating Writing - Story openings
sutty6sutty6

Creating Writing - Story openings

(0)
A range of resources prompting students to create effective story openings, looking at a range of ways to engage the reader -Directly targeting the reader -Describing something strange -Immediate Action -Pathetic Fallacy Group work can be adapted to work individually and writing on tables can be adapted to create a range of story openings in books. Includes Peer Assessment strategies

Descriptive writing - varying sentence structure for effect
sutty6sutty6

Descriptive writing - varying sentence structure for effect

(0)
The lesson focuses on describing an image to create mood - involves varying sentence structures and including a range of appropriate adjectives Peer Assessment task works brilliantly with students once they are coached - always make students write their name along with strength and target so they can be held accountable for good and bad feedback
